Autodesk New Transaction Process Announced for the US and Canada
Autodesk launched a new transaction process to customers who purchase subscriptions in Australia in November 2023. Following a successful trial, they have announced a go-live date of 10th June 2024 for the US & Canada. No timeline has been shared for other geographies, but Autodesk does intend to roll the new process out globally over the next 2 years.
In the new process, Symetri are still involved in all phases of the pre-and post-sales experience except for the actual order and payment transaction, which happens directly between the customer and Autodesk as it does with Flex today. Symetri will still have responsibility for all post-sales activities such as onboarding, training and support. The process for buying other third-party software, Symetri Tech, or our own services remains unchanged.
